Definitions

  • the invention relates to a folding apparatus according to the preamble of claim 1.
  • the DD 41 520 describes a Winder, whose Falzmesseronia is switchable by means of two different planet gears between two modes. A change of the fold on the product is not provided.
  • DE 197 55 428 A1 shows a device for adjusting the folding mechanisms on a folding cylinder of a folding apparatus.
  • DE 12 22 082 B discloses a folder with a rotatable folding blade cylinder for conveying a signature to be folded.
  • the folding blade cylinder has a folding blade, which is rotatable about a first axis, which in turn is held on a rotatable about a second axis support and in the course of its rotation from the folding blade cylinder is extendable.
  • the rotation of the folding blade is coupled with variable phase to the rotation of the folding blade.
  • the folding blade cylinder is rotationally coupled by a transmission gear to a knife cylinder.
  • the invention has for its object to provide a folder.
  • the achievable with the present invention consist in particular in that the used for adjusting the relative phase of the carrier relative to the transport cylinder differential gear phase adjustment exclusively by rotational movements and not caused by translational movements, and that the size of a differential gear - in contrast to that of a linear actuator - is independent of the realizable with him phase shift.
  • usable differential gear are standard parts that are industrially produced in large quantities and are available inexpensively. Preferred types of such differential gears are harmonic drive gears or planetary gears.
  • a differential gear Of the three input or output members of such a differential gear one is preferably connected to a servomotor equipped with a brake. This motor is only in operation as long as the phase is adjusted; when the folder is operating normally, the engine is deactivated and the brake is applied.
  • the folding blade cylinder of the folder preferably has a plurality of holders such as grippers or rows of puncturing needles for holding a product to be conveyed.
  • the folding blade cylinder In order to cut the products to be folded from a continuous product strand, the folding blade cylinder preferably cooperates with a knife cylinder.
  • the number m of the knives on the knife cylinder may be smaller than the number n of holders on the folding blade cylinder, if both are rotationally coupled by a transmission gear ratio of n / m, that they have the same peripheral speeds.
  • the carrier can be coupled in a simple manner to the blade cylinder through the differential gear with transmission ratio 1: 1.

Claims (14)

  1. Appareil de pliage avec un cylindre à lames de pliage (18) rotatif, pour le transport d'une signature (31) à plier, avec au moins une lame de pliage (04) susceptible de tourner à l'intérieur d'un cylindre de lames de pliage (18) autour d'un premier axe (27), qui, de son côté, est maintenu sur un support (20) susceptible de tourner autour d'un deuxième axe (26), et qui est déployable hors du cylindre à lames de pliage (18) au cours de sa rotation, l'appareil de pliage étant entraîné par au moins un moteur électrique (59 ; 61) propre, mécaniquement indépendamment des autres agrégats, deux rouleaux de pliage (32) formant un intervalle de pliage étant disposés, un moulinet (33) étant disposé, caractérisé en ce que, pendant le processus de pliage, le moulinet (33) est entraîné par un moteur électrique (62) propre non couplé à un cylindre, et en ce que, pendant le processus de pliage, le cylindre à lames de pliage (18) et la lame de pliage (19) sont entraînés par un moteur électrique (38) commun, ou en ce que, pendant le processus de pliage, le cylindre à lames de pliage (18) est entraîné par un moteur électrique (59) propre, non couplé à un autre cylindre.
  2. Appareil de pliage selon la revendication 1, caractérisé en ce que, pendant le processus de pliage, le cylindre à lames (19) est entraîné par un moteur électrique (61) propre, non couplé à un autre cylindre.
  3. Appareil de pliage selon la revendication 1, caractérisé en ce que, pendant le processus de pliage, l'axe (26) du support (20) est entraîné par un autre moteur électrique (58).
  4. Appareil de pliage selon la revendication 1, caractérisé en ce que le moteur électrique (58) du support (20) n'est pas relié mécaniquement à l'entraînement du cylindre à lames de pliage (18).
  5. Appareil de pliage selon la revendication 1, caractérisé en ce que les rouleaux de pliage (32) sont entraînés conjointement par un moteur électrique (63) propre, non couplé à un cylindre.
  6. Appareil de pliage selon la revendication 1, caractérisé en ce que chacun des deux rouleaux de pliage (32) est entraîné par un moteur électrique (64 ; 65) propre.
  7. Appareil de pliage selon la revendication 1, caractérisé en ce qu'un système de bande de transport (34) est prévu.
  8. Appareil de pliage selon la revendication 7, caractérisé en ce que le système à bande de transport (34) est entraîné par un moteur électrique (66) propre.
  9. Appareil de pliage selon la revendication 1, 5, 6 ou 7, caractérisé en ce que les moteurs électriques (38 ; 58 ; 59 ; 61 ; 62 ; 63 ; 64; 65 ; 66) sont munis d'une régulation de la position angulaire.
  10. Appareil de pliage selon l'une des revendications 1 à 9, caractérisé en ce qu'un dispositif de régulation, prévu pour la régulation de la position de phase des moteurs électriques (38 ; 58 ; 59 ; 61 ; 62 ; 63 ; 64; 65 ; 66) entre eux, est prévu.
  11. Appareil de pliage selon la revendication 3, caractérisé en ce que la position de phase, du moteur électrique (58), du support (20) et du moteur électrique (59) du cylindre à lames de pliage (18), les uns par rapport aux autres, est modifiable, et un dispositif de régulation est prévu pour modifier la position de phase.
  12. Appareil de pliage selon la revendication 1 et 3, ou 1 et 5, ou 1 et 6, ou 3 et 5, ou 3 et 6, caractérisé en ce que la position de phase et/ou la vitesse de rotation du moteur électrique (58) du support (20) et/ou du moteur électrique (59) du cylindre à lames de pliage (18), et du moteur électrique (63 ; 64 ; 65) des rouleaux de pliage (32), les uns par rapport aux autres, est modifiable, et un dispositif de régulation afférent est prévu, pour modifier cette position de phase et/ou cette vitesse de rotation.
  13. Appareil de pliage selon la revendication 1, caractérisé en ce que la position de phase du moteur électrique (62) du moulinet (33) et d'au moins un autre moteur électrique (38 ; 58 ; 59 ; 61 ; 63 ; 64 ; 65 ; 66) les uns par rapport aux autres est modifiable et un dispositif de régulation afférent est prévu pour modifier cette régulation de phase.
  14. Appareil de pliage selon la revendication 8, caractérisé en ce que la position de phase du moteur électrique (62) du moulinet (33), et du moteur électrique (66) du système à bande de transport (34), les uns par rapport aux autres, est modifiable, et un dispositif de régulation afférent est prévu, pour modifier la position de phase et/ou la vitesse de rotation.
